The Enduring Allure of Black and White:
The choice of black and white is far from arbitrary. It's a classic combination that transcends fleeting trends, embodying both sophistication and versatility. Within the context of Chanel, this pairing resonates deeply with the brand's founding principles. Coco Chanel herself championed the simplicity and elegance of monochrome, often incorporating black and white into her designs to create a sense of understated luxury. This approach stands in stark contrast to the flamboyant styles prevalent in the early 20th century, reflecting Chanel's revolutionary approach to women's fashion. The stark contrast between black and white creates a visual drama that is both captivating and refined, a signature element of the Chanel aesthetic.
